BECC as a learning experience by Dagna
I invite you for a self-directed learning journey, which starts now (the moment you read this introduction), and ends at the evaluation phase of this project.
I will offer different tools supporting your self-reflection, self-assessment and self-empowerment in the context of your professional development. Moreover, I will stimulate the group process underlying the importance of a learning community and stimulating creativity grounded in micro-interactions. You may expect individual work, small chats with me, work with your learning peers and within the whole group.
Using the digital process for reaching out and increasing participation by Andrea and Katrin
The spirit that guides the training will be collaboration: get in contact, share experiences and knowledge, explore new tools and digital possibilities, expand your network, learn from each other, get ideas for participative audience work.
The training will be participative, there will be the space to develop and experiment crossmedia together, in action. Some people will contribute to the training online and there is a field trip planned to get inspiration and insights from outside.
The focus is on the process and the power of strategic networking in an analog and digital way, during the whole workshop days and the digital shift hours. We involve people, their knowledge, experience, skills and needs. The participants will get in touch with their vision, share their ideas, tools and projects, explore the possibilities, make connections, scout their space, focus on their target groups and multipliers, and expand their services, always keeping in mind the strategic red line. Exploring and expanding the skills is the topic.
The following questions will be guiding us:
- How do we use digital tools to think strategically? What is our content?
- How can digital tools support my goal, my project, my team, my community?
- How can I reach different targets, a new audience?
The workshop structure:
- get in contact - participative digital networking
- the magic of structure, network and (digital) space and
- how to manage these strategically to keep the focus and achieve our communication goals
- discover together the digital tools and the practical power of cooperation
